Most Chameleon members perform in orchestras and as chamber musicians and soloists in the Boston area.
The program culminates in concerts and an instrument petting zoo at Forsyth Chapel at Forest Hills Cemetery.
Chameleon works with composer, storyteller and educator Hans Indigo Spencer to design the program.
It has donated over 1000 thousand tickets to organizations such as the Pine Street Inn, the Metropolitan Boston Housing Partnership, and Project Step.
Chameleon's first concert in October 1998 was reviewed by Richard Buell of The Boston Globe: “...what should appear on the scene but another new outfit – its members eager and young, to be sure, but with nothing whatever to blush about as to technique, musical smarts, or knowing what goes with what on a program.
